Welcome to on-call for the Glimmerpane design system! Our snapshot tests live in the `snapcheck` suite and run on every merge to main. If a UI component changes visually, the diff bot flags it — usually it's an intentional tweak, so just approve the new baseline. If it's 2am and snapshots are failing across the board, it's almost always a font-loading race, not your problem. To unlock the baseline store and re-approve snapshots in bulk, use the recovery passphrase below.

recovery phrase for tahag-taguf: wenix-caswyn

## Deployment: Hot-Reloading Configuration

The Quillgate service watches its config file and applies changes without a restart. Reviewers should verify that new keys are registered in the reload handler, otherwise they are silently ignored until the next full deploy. Connection pool settings are the exception and always require a restart. The current reloadable values are listed below.

service settings:
[casax]
port = 6379
team = rusir
host = casax.zemvarhq.corp
region = outer-4
access_code = ac_9808ce
timeout_ms = 1500

**Wiki: FareLab data stores**

Quick rundown for the sync: the FareLab ticket-pricing experiment writes price variants to the `variants` store and conversion events to `outcomes`. Dashboards read from a nightly rollup, so don't panic if numbers lag a day. The assignment service caches in memory — restart it if buckets look stale. Everything lives in one Postgres instance for now (yes, we know). For local poking, connect with the string below.

replica DSN, kajep-yahag: mssql://praok_svc:iF@db-8d68.plorvaio.local:5432/eliion

**Action item (PM-2141, diff viewer):** The Larkspool diff viewer stalled on files over a few hundred megabytes because chunking thresholds were hardcoded and tuned for source files, not generated assets. As the contractor picking this up, move the thresholds into the config module and add a guard that falls back to summary-only mode past the hard cap. Keep defaults conservative; we'd rather degrade than hang. The agreed starting values are listed below.

constants for tageg-kagag:
QUOTAS = {
    "kelax": 495,
    "istath": 366,
    "tammir": 108,
    "novdor": 730,
    "casax": 816,
    "quenael": 874,
    "pelius": 403,
}